Northrop Grumman
Understanding the application of principles, concepts, practices, and standards. Independently demonstrates the skill and ability to perform fairly complex professional tasks. Develops solutions to a variety of complex problems. May refer to established precedents and policies. Performs fairly complex tasks and participates in determining objectives of assignment. Plan schedules and arranges own activities in accomplishing objectives. Work is reviewed upon completion for adequacy in meeting objective. Exerts some influence on the overall objectives and long-range goals of the organization. Erroneous decisions or failure to achieve objectives would normally have a serious effect upon the administration of the organization Represents organization as a prime contact on contracts or projects. Interacts with senior internal and external personnel on significant matters often requiring coordination between organizations. May develop and deliver presentations. Plan, schedule, and conduct internal audits to ensure compliance with AS9100, CMMI, customer, and regulatory requirements. Evaluate processes, procedures, and records to verify adherence to organizational quality standards. Document audit findings, identify non-conformances, and work with process owners to develop and implement corrective actions. Support external audits by regulatory bodies, customers, or certification authorities by providing required documentation and evidence of compliance. Prepare audit reports and present results to leadership, including insights for process improvements. Assist in maintaining QMS documentation, including policies, procedures, and work instructions. Provide training and support to teams on quality and compliance topics as needed. Assist with special projects designed to enhance auditor's efficiency and experience Must be a US Citizen Must have the ability to obtain and maintain a U.S. Government DoD security clearance (Secret, Top Secret; etc.) Bachelor's degree and a minimum of 5 years of professional related industry, or a Masters degree with 3 years of experience, or a PHD with 1 year of experience; or 9 years of experience in lieu of degree. 3 years' experience working in an AS9100 or ISO9001 compliant organization. 2 years' experience in developing or reviewing a Quality Management System Currently or Previously AS9100 or ISO 9001 Lead Auditor Certified (may be expired) 1+ Year Root Cause and Corrective Action experience. Experience in ICBMs or Aerospace programs Five years' experience managing Quality Management Systems (QMS) Experience with document control process Excellent verbal and written communication skills. Ability to collaborate in a team environment.
